Welcome to on-call for the Glimmerpane design system! Our snapshot tests live in the `snapcheck` suite and run on every merge to main. If a UI component changes visually, the diff bot flags it — usually it's an intentional tweak, so just approve the new baseline. If it's 2am and snapshots are failing across the board, it's almost always a font-loading race, not your problem. To unlock the baseline store and re-approve snapshots in bulk, use the recovery passphrase below.

recovery phrase for tahag-taguf: wenix-caswyn

Heads up, new folks: the Chalkline timetable solver's CI job sometimes fails on the constraint-propagation tests when the runner picks the smaller memory tier. It's not your change — just retry with the "solver-heavy" label. If it fails twice in a row, ping the build channel and include the token printed at the end of the solver stage.

session token of fahap-hawip = htk31_7852f2b3276dba2738f98fa97f92237

Runbook: WebSocket reconnect storm (Bridgewire gateway). Symptom: plugins flap every ~30s after a gateway restart. Cause: stale session tokens rejected, client retries immediately. Fix: plugins must honor the backoff headers; do not implement your own retry loop. Verify with the echo endpoint before escalating. Reconnect ceilings, jitter, and token lifetimes are all configurable server-side. Current production settings follow.

deployment values, yadup-kadug:
[sorys]
port = 5672
team = noveth
host = sorys.orvexcorp.example
region = south-4
access_code = ac_deddc1
timeout_ms = 1500

Subject: Handover — Tollgate payments tests

Hey all — quick handover before I'm out. The integration tests on Tollgate's payments service are flaky again, mostly the settlement-webhook suite. If your plugin build fails there, just rerun once before panicking; Priya is working on a proper fix. Plugin submissions still go through the normal channel. To publish a signed plugin release while I'm away, use the key I've dropped in right below.

deploy key for kajof-fajop: bky6_gDHw9Q